Constant Summary collapse
- BUILDIDENTIFIER =
/[0-9A-Za-z-]+/
- BUILD =
/(?:\+(#{BUILDIDENTIFIER.source}(?:\.#{BUILDIDENTIFIER.source})*))/
- NUMERICIDENTIFIER =
/0|[1-9]\d*/
- NUMERICIDENTIFIERLOOSE =
/[0-9]+/
- NONNUMERICIDENTIFIER =
/\d*[a-zA-Z-][a-zA-Z0-9-]*/
- XRANGEIDENTIFIERLOOSE =
/#{NUMERICIDENTIFIERLOOSE.source}|x|X|\*/
- PRERELEASEIDENTIFIERLOOSE =
/(?:#{NUMERICIDENTIFIERLOOSE.source}|#{NONNUMERICIDENTIFIER.source})/
- PRERELEASELOOSE =
/(?:-?(#{PRERELEASEIDENTIFIERLOOSE.source}(?:\.#{PRERELEASEIDENTIFIERLOOSE.source})*))/
- XRANGEPLAINLOOSE =
/[v=\s]*(#{XRANGEIDENTIFIERLOOSE.source})(?:\.(#{XRANGEIDENTIFIERLOOSE.source})(?:\.(#{XRANGEIDENTIFIERLOOSE.source})(?:#{PRERELEASELOOSE.source})?#{BUILD.source}?)?)?/
- HYPHENRANGELOOSE =
/^\s*(#{XRANGEPLAINLOOSE.source})\s+-\s+(#{XRANGEPLAINLOOSE.source})\s*$/
- PRERELEASEIDENTIFIER =
/(?:#{NUMERICIDENTIFIER.source}|#{NONNUMERICIDENTIFIER.source})/
- PRERELEASE =
/(?:-(#{PRERELEASEIDENTIFIER.source}(?:\.#{PRERELEASEIDENTIFIER.source})*))/
- XRANGEIDENTIFIER =
/#{NUMERICIDENTIFIER.source}|x|X|\*/
- XRANGEPLAIN =
/[v=\s]*(#{XRANGEIDENTIFIER.source})(?:\.(#{XRANGEIDENTIFIER.source})(?:\.(#{XRANGEIDENTIFIER.source})(?:#{PRERELEASE.source})?#{BUILD.source}?)?)?/
- HYPHENRANGE =
/^\s*(#{XRANGEPLAIN.source})\s+-\s+(#{XRANGEPLAIN.source})\s*$/
- MAINVERSIONLOOSE =
/(#{NUMERICIDENTIFIERLOOSE.source})\.(#{NUMERICIDENTIFIERLOOSE.source})\.(#{NUMERICIDENTIFIERLOOSE.source})/
- LOOSEPLAIN =
/[v=\s]*#{MAINVERSIONLOOSE.source}#{PRERELEASELOOSE.source}?#{BUILD.source}?/
- GTLT =
/((?:<|>)?=?)/
- COMPARATORTRIM =
/(\s*)#{GTLT.source}\s*(#{LOOSEPLAIN.source}|#{XRANGEPLAIN.source})/
- LONETILDE =
/(?:~>?)/
- TILDETRIM =
/(\s*)#{LONETILDE.source}\s+/
- LONECARET =
/(?:\^)/
- CARETTRIM =
/(\s*)#{LONECARET.source}\s+/
- STAR =
/(<|>)?=?\s*\*/
- CARET =
/^#{LONECARET.source}#{XRANGEPLAIN.source}$/
- CARETLOOSE =
/^#{LONECARET.source}#{XRANGEPLAINLOOSE.source}$/
- MAINVERSION =
/(#{NUMERICIDENTIFIER.source})\.(#{NUMERICIDENTIFIER.source})\.(#{NUMERICIDENTIFIER.source})/
- FULLPLAIN =
/v?#{MAINVERSION.source}#{PRERELEASE.source}?#{BUILD.source}?/
- FULL =
/^#{FULLPLAIN.source}$/
- LOOSE =
/^#{LOOSEPLAIN.source}$/
- TILDE =
/^#{LONETILDE.source}#{XRANGEPLAIN.source}$/
- TILDELOOSE =
/^#{LONETILDE.source}#{XRANGEPLAINLOOSE.source}$/
- XRANGE =
/^#{GTLT.source}\s*#{XRANGEPLAIN.source}$/
- XRANGELOOSE =
/^#{GTLT.source}\s*#{XRANGEPLAINLOOSE.source}$/
- COMPARATOR =
/^#{GTLT.source}\s*(#{FULLPLAIN.source})$|^$/
- COMPARATORLOOSE =
/^#{GTLT.source}\s*(#{LOOSEPLAIN.source})$|^$/
- ANY =
{}
- MAX_LENGTH =
256
- VERSION =
"3.0.0"

Class Method Details
.clean(version, loose: false) ⇒ Object
229 230 231 232 |
# File 'lib/semantic_range.rb', line 229 def self.clean(version, loose: false) s = parse(version.strip.gsub(/^[=v]+/, ''), loose: loose) return s ? s.version : nil end |
.cmp(a, op, b, loose: false) ⇒ Object
61 62 63 64 65 66 67 68 69 70 71 72 73 74 75 76 77 78 79 80 81 82 83 84 85 86 |
# File 'lib/semantic_range.rb', line 61 def self.cmp(a, op, b, loose: false) case op when '===' a = a.version if !a.is_a?(String) b = b.version if !b.is_a?(String) a == b when '!==' a = a.version if !a.is_a?(String) b = b.version if !b.is_a?(String) a != b when '', '=', '==' eq?(a, b, loose: loose) when '!=' neq?(a, b, loose: loose) when '>' gt?(a, b, loose: loose) when '>=' gte?(a, b, loose: loose) when '<' lt?(a, b, loose: loose) when '<=' lte?(a, b, loose: loose) else raise 'Invalid operator: ' + op end end |
.compare(a, b, loose: false) ⇒ Object
180 181 182 |
# File 'lib/semantic_range.rb', line 180 def self.compare(a, b, loose: false) Version.new(a, loose: loose).compare(b) end |

.diff(a, b) ⇒ Object
255 256 257 258 259 260 261 262 263 264 |
# File 'lib/semantic_range.rb', line 255 def self.diff(a, b) a = Version.new(a, loose: false) unless a.kind_of?(Version) b = Version.new(b, loose: false) unless b.kind_of?(Version) pre_diff = a.prerelease.to_s != b.prerelease.to_s pre = pre_diff ? 'pre' : '' return "#{pre}major" if a.major != b.major return "#{pre}minor" if a.minor != b.minor return "#{pre}patch" if a.patch != b.patch return "prerelease" if pre_diff end |

.outside?(version, range, hilo, loose: false, platform: nil) ⇒ Boolean Also known as: outside
88 89 90 91 92 93 94 95 96 97 98 99 100 101 102 103 104 105 106 107 108 109 110 111 112 113 114 115 116 117 118 119 120 121 122 123 124 125 126 127 128 129 130 131 132 133 134 135 136 137 138 139 140 141 142 143 144 145 146 147 148 149 |
# File 'lib/semantic_range.rb', line 88 def self.outside?(version, range, hilo, loose: false, platform: nil) version = Version.new(version, loose: loose) range = Range.new(range, loose: loose, platform: platform) return false if satisfies?(version, range, loose: loose, platform: platform) case hilo when '>' comp = '>' ecomp = '>=' when '<' comp = '<' ecomp = '<=' end range.set.each do |comparators| high = nil low = nil comparators.each do |comparator| if comparator.semver == ANY comparator = Comparator.new('>=0.0.0', loose) end high = high || comparator low = low || comparator case hilo when '>' if gt?(comparator.semver, high.semver, loose: loose) high = comparator elsif lt?(comparator.semver, low.semver, loose: loose) low = comparator end when '<' if lt?(comparator.semver, high.semver, loose: loose) high = comparator elsif gt?(comparator.semver, low.semver, loose: loose) low = comparator end end end return false if (high.operator == comp || high.operator == ecomp) case hilo when '>' if (low.operator.empty? || low.operator == comp) && lte?(version, low.semver, loose: loose) return false; elsif (low.operator == ecomp && lt?(version, low.semver, loose: loose)) return false; end when '<' if (low.operator.empty? || low.operator == comp) && gte?(version, low.semver, loose: loose) return false; elsif low.operator == ecomp && gt?(version, low.semver, loose: loose) return false; end end end true end |
.parse(version, loose: false) ⇒ Object
234 235 236 237 238 239 240 241 242 243 244 245 246 247 |
# File 'lib/semantic_range.rb', line 234 def self.parse(version, loose: false) return version if version.is_a?(Version) return nil unless version.is_a?(String) stripped_version = version.strip return nil if stripped_version.length > MAX_LENGTH rxp = loose ? LOOSE : FULL return nil if !rxp.match(stripped_version) Version.new(stripped_version, loose: loose) end |
